Kargil 02-Feb-2018

Meanwhile, replying to a question of Asgar Ali Karbalaie, Deputy Chief Minister informed the House that the Government has earmarked Rs. 42.44 crore for strengthening the power infrastructure and electrification of uncovered villages in Kargil district under DDUGJY. He said the work for execution has been entrusted to PGCIL Company. “Presently, EM&RE Division Kargil is run by 238 staff members including engineering and supervisory headed by an executive engineer. To meet out the deficiency of staff in EM&RE Division Kargil, 190 Casual/Need Based Workers have been engaged by the department from time to time for maintenance and smooth distribution of supply,” he added.1250.36 kanals land leased out for industriesMinister for Industries and Commerce, Mr Chander Prakash informed the Legislative Assembly that Industries Department has provided/transferred 1250.36 kanals of land on lease basis against an amount of Rs 193.87 crore. Replying to a question by Mr Altaf Ahmad Wani, the Minister said that no land has been unlawfully transferred to any non-state subjects by the Industries and Commerce Department.
